Pastoral Associates (PAs) are a group of caring lay people who are invited by the minister to assist with outreach to members of the congregation who are experienceing a time of special need. We provide practical assistance, social connection, and emotional support during times of crisis or difficult periods of transition. We are there to share in the celebration of joyous life events as well.
The kinds of things we do:
- Visit members and friends who are homebound or hospitalized
- Arrange for transportation to medical appointments or to Sunday services
- Provide phone calls or visits to those in need of comfort, care and support related to major life transitions, care giving issues, personal crisis, or bereavement
- Run an important errand to ease the burder during hardships
- Assist with finding additional resources for services and supports within the community
- Offer educational workshops on such topics as healthy communication skills, bereavement, memory and aging, and suicide awareness
- Deliver a meal or two during times of illness, recovery or loss
We can be of help to you during times of:
- Sudden or prolonged illness
- Change in health
- Transition to a new career
- Challenging parenting issues
- Birth or adoption of a baby
- Loss of a loved one, a job, or an important life role
- Divorce, or separation from life partner
- Social isolation homebound due to illness or disability
- Taking on the role of care giver for an aged parent

Emergency / End of Life Planning
Please download an In Case of Emergency (ICE) / End of Life Planning form so we know how best to assist you in an emergency. All members are encouraged to complete this form in order to assist the Pastoral Associates and Minister in responding to your needs when you are ill or dealing with an emergency. Please print a paper copy to send or give to the Minister. Copies will be stored in a locked file in the Minister's office and can be revised or replaced at any time. Copies of Advance Directives (health care proxies and/or living wills) can also be submitted for filing.
